Output 16e8ec1cf925eb3f59835b0b318c1da315aed1ad041b806e1160f29dcf80d1ce:3

value
183721660
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f5956aabc40aa2a55528aabcd8e125e6f9fde6da OP_EQUALVERIFY OP_CHECKSIG
address
1PPXYeo41rUL8Bn1fvCsN3C5W1VfBTUprL
transaction
16e8ec1cf925eb3f59835b0b318c1da315aed1ad041b806e1160f29dcf80d1ce
confirmations
510091
spent
true